Histopathological, magnetic resonance (MR) and ultrasound correlates of mammographic density in BRCA1-2 mutation carriers [ 2008 - 2010 ]

Brief description Mammographic density (MD), is a major risk factor for breast cancer. The nature of breast tissue underlying MD is not clear. The study will clarify the nature of breast tissue underlying MD as well as determining the breast MRI and ultrasound features that correlate with MD. These findings will enhance knowledge of breast cancer development, and should help to avoid mammography to screen young, high risk women and fulfil a priority objective of Cancer Australia
